Description

The sub-county of Salgótarján is one of the places which are contaminated by crimes. The local settlements have the need for preventive initiations however the activeness is weak among the communities; the civic guard organizations are professionally not prepared and their social reputation is low. Winning the support for this project made people more enthusiastic that can be a good base for activating local resources in a long term. The main objective of the project is to develop their previous results and the movement itself, to show best practices and to establish a Civic Crime Prevention Educational Center in which the trainings of activists will be realized. The Centre aims to ensure a basement where the surveillance camera system and also a law enforcement exhibition will take place. The project promoter will edit a publication, organizing trainings, meeting, professionals’ forums, all-day community programs and a conference. The target group includes the activists and supporters of the Movement (40 persons), and aims to achieve 19 civic guard organizations (about 400 people).

Summary of project results

Local crime prevention activities in the district are important, but the professional know-how, the social acceptance, the cooperation among the organizations and common actions are missing. The aim was to improve the ’Neighbours for Each Other Movement’ on the district level, to share best practices and establish a District Civil Crime Prevention Centre and Training Base as a model, where the training of crime prevention NGOs and the ’NEOM’ activists can take place, and thereby the cooperation of the local community, and strengthening of the broader civil sector can come true. The target groups were the members of the civil crime prevention organizations and the whole population. Activities of the project included a District Neighbourhood Watch Day, a conference, team-building and nine trainings for local neighbourhood watch organizations in the region, and marketing actions. Based on the mobilizing effect of the local resources, the civic organizations involved into the project will be able to implement their aims on higher level, the cooperation become closer, the common thinking and action have been launched. As a result of the project a common thinking had been launched among the local neighbourhood watch organizations in the region, and on the long run their cooperation was enhanced, which is expected to be resulted in concrete future cooperation projects. But the project also contributed to strengthening the cohesion of local communities. The local neighbourhood watch organizations in the region were not sufficiently prepared, their local embeddedness were weak, and local people didn’t efficiently supported their work as lacking of interest and information, knowledge about their work. As a result of the project, the local neighbourhood watch organizations in the region could successfully involve new members, and they could train their staff, members, so their professional preparedness was improved. The members of the local neighbourhood watch organizations in the region together mapped the main problems realized by them in the region, so a united view had been designed about the main problems, sources of threats of the region. A guide book was also elaborated about the professional necessary knowledge and information for local neighbourhood watch organizations in the region.
